Description

2 bedroom 1 bath duplex for rent featuring large windows, radiant in floor heat, knotty pine finishes, a covered front porch, off street parking, laundry, and dishwasher. Located on the West side, a quick hop to the bike path, nearby parks, and a 5 minute walk to downtown. Enjoy an energy efficient, healthy home, with year-round stable temperatures in this slab on grade building with radiant in floor heat and HRV air circulation.

Available May 1st. One year lease (through May 31, 2027) renewable thereafter. $2200 damage and security deposit. Non-smoking property. Tenant pays utilities. Pets on a case by case basis with $500 deposit per pet. To apply please submit application on Zillow. Sufficient income to cover rent and landlord reference will be needed.
